I typically spend $180-$300 on raw denim. But I'm really into raw selvage denim.
Raw Selvage denim typically is made in Japan and ages and fades naturally over time with lots of wear.
You typically wear selvage jeans for 6+ months w/ out washing (you put them in the freezer to eliminate bacteria).
